Apprentice Administrator - ECO Framework

Key Accountabilities

Check for new work (candidates) on various platforms/spreadsheets and add new jobs to our internal spreadsheet Issue new (reviewed) works information to the contractor Prompt the contractors for weekly progress updates Assist with any queries from contractors/clients and help with SharePoint updates Ensure to follow a strict checking process when reviewing contractor updates before accepting from the contractor. Includes querying comments, dates and measurements Update client’s corporate systems with dates, progress and completion information Review completed work information and check that all work has been completed Assist in compiling weekly progress reports Attend weekly team meetings

Employer Description:
Esh Construction is the main trading arm of Esh Group, one of the region’s leading privately-owned construction, development, and property services businesses. Operating across the North of England we provide civil engineering, affordable housing, refurbishment, private housing and commercial build services to the private and public sector. Our steady growth to date is testament to our knowledgeable workforce who work collaboratively with our clients to deliver outstanding projects. We have an uncompromising focus on health, safety and quality, and promote a culture that empowers our workforce to be forward thinking and innovative. We are committed to eliminating carbon from our operations by 2040 and to be a ‘truly local’ contractor; supporting the communities and economies in the areas we work through our Queen’s Award winning ‘Constructing Local’ strategy.
